999精品在线视频,手机成人午夜在线视频,久久不卡国产精品无码,中日无码在线观看,成人av手机在线观看,日韩精品亚洲一区中文字幕,亚洲av无码人妻,四虎国产在线观看 ?

基于.NET的網上圖書采購系統設計與實現

2012-10-13 06:22:38張國杰
河南圖書館學刊 2012年5期
關鍵詞:數據庫圖書館信息

張國杰

(廣東第二師范學院圖書館,廣東 廣州 510310)

1 國內外圖書采購系統的研究現狀和意義

1.1 國內這一方面缺乏系統的、全面的研究

國內現在有條件的圖書館所使用的采購系統概括起來有兩類,一是圖書自動化管理系統集成的薦購模塊,如深圳圖書館開發的ILAS圖書管理系統里的圖書薦購模塊,該系統數據庫采用圖書館專用數據庫LDBM,但存在數據格式復雜、征訂目錄檢索方式不靈活、兼容性不強、使用不方便的缺點;再如“匯文”圖書館管理系統中的圖書薦購系統是所有圖書館管理系統中功能實現相對較好的,但也存在不足,比如在檢索書目時沒有薦購選項,供讀者檢索的征訂目錄僅僅是導入的書目,不支持高級檢索和在結果中查詢等等[1]。二是各家圖書供應商開發的選書系統,如人天書店的網上選書系統,此類系統存在一定局限性,只為自家的征訂目錄有效運行,且商業性較強,當多家圖書供應商為同一家圖書館供書時可能出現重書情況,查重工作變得復雜,并且僅有圖書采購信息的收集功能,沒有圖書的驗收功能[2]。當然,現在還有較多圖書館沒有使用相應的采購系統,而是通過網頁的表單推薦、Email方式、紙質書目圈選等方式來收集采購的書目信息,然后再通過查重軟件進行查重校對,最后再進行下訂單購買的形式來完成采購工作。這些做法都還沒有達到建設現代化圖書館的標準,都不能適應社會信息化高度發展要求。且多數圖書館的薦購系統只注重推薦,忽略驗收環節,缺乏系統的連貫性。

1.2 國外圖書館也沒有一套完善而高效的圖書采購系統

經過筆者在網上對國外重點高校圖書館網站的觀察研究,國外高校例如哈佛大學、耶魯大學、劍橋大學3間圖書館圖書薦購系統都是采用網頁表單提交的形式,僅僅是傳統紙質薦購單的簡單電子化,未形成一套完善的圖書采購系統。究其原因,可能是國外高校圖書館的學科館員體系較為成熟,學科館員通過其他的形式完成了對讀者需求信息的收集,導致國外對薦購系統研究文獻不多,但國外圖書館對圖書采購系統也有較強的需求[3][4]。

1.3 網上圖書采購系統有利于提升圖書館整體服務水平

首先,傳統的采購中,由于書目信息收集時間久,經歷過程長,難以對讀者推薦的圖書進行跟蹤處理,直接打擊了讀者薦購積極性,網絡化、電子化的圖書采購方式更受讀者歡迎,可以調動起讀者推薦圖書熱情,適應時代的發展;其次,在圖書到館驗收環節中,傳統的驗收對判斷到館圖書是否為本館所訂購的圖書問題上有很大的難度,難以甄別圖書供應商亂發貨的圖書,常常造成圖書館與圖書供應商之間的不必要矛盾沖突,而采購系統輕松解決了這方面問題,清晰記錄了圖書采購的各個過程產生的數據,做到有根有據,減少出錯率,提高了圖書館工作水平,從而也提升了圖書館整體服務水平。再次,該系統可有效緩解文獻采購數量的有限性與讀者日益增長的信息需求之間的矛盾,解決采購人員知識結構不全面性與信息內容復雜性的矛盾,加快了圖書采購速度,提高了圖書驗收工作的效率,達到以最快的速度傳播文獻信息的目的。并且,網上圖書采購系統的實現將更好地把圖書供應商、圖書館工作人員以及讀者之間的聯系建立起來,信息得到更快的反饋,讓溝通變得更加容易,亦使預購圖書數據庫、到館書目庫和館藏數據庫同一時間結合在一起,更有利于分析采購數據,查看推薦預測讀者閱讀動態,為圖書館進一步服務提供參考。

2 系統設計

2.1 系統功能模塊設計

通過實際調研,圖書館圖書采購工作指的就是圖書供應商提供最新圖書目錄,讀者將他們所需要的圖書信息提供給圖書館采購部門,圖書館采購人員根據本館實際情況,再決定該圖書是否購買,圖書驗收人員再對采訪后進館的圖書進行驗收,甄別圖書是否為所采購圖書或者是否適合館藏,本論文研究中認為一個網上圖書采購系統,其功能應為:①通過登錄驗證,進入相應的角色模塊;②圖書供應商可以維護個人信息、上傳最新圖書書目信息和下載已生成的訂書信息;③讀者可以檢索自己所喜歡類別的圖書目錄信息并進行薦購、自薦圖書登記及薦購信息管理;④圖書采購組可以對讀者薦購信息進行處理并對處理后生成的訂書信息進行管理;⑤圖書驗收組可以進行到館圖書驗收處理,并可以管理已購進圖書、退書及未到圖書的信息;⑥管理員可以進行對圖書信息管理,圖書供應商、讀者、圖書館用戶的信息管理。該系統可為多個圖書供應商提供同一采購平臺,實現多個圖書供應商共同為同一家圖書館供書而又不重復供書的功能,亦為圖書采訪后的驗收工作提供高效服務,快速去除驗收不合格的圖書數據,快速登記到館合格的圖書,生成相應報表,為領導提供決策參考[5]-[6]。

2.2 系統數據庫設計

根據圖書館圖書采購的業務流程,本系統共設計了12個數據庫表,分別為圖書信息表(BookInfo)、圖書館用戶表(LibrarianInfo)、圖書供應商信息表(BookSuplierInfo)、讀者信息表(ReaderInfo)、部門信息表(DeptInfo)、讀者類型信息表(ReaderTypeInfo)、薦購信息表(JiangouInfo)、讀者自薦書目信息表(ZijianInfo)、館藏信息表(GuancangInfo)、訂購書目明細信息表(DinggouInfo)、驗收后進館圖書明細信息表(JinguanInfo)、驗收后退書圖書明細信息表(TuishuInfo)。圖書采購系統數據庫關系圖見圖1。

圖1 圖書采購系統數據庫關系圖

3 系統主要功能的實現及關鍵技術

3.1 數據導入功能的實現

圖書書目數據上傳模塊為該系統開發中遇到的難點之一,數據格式匹配不允許任何的錯誤,務必準確。本系統先讀取Excel表,存入DataSet中,然后在將DataSet中的數據轉入圖書館圖書采購數據庫BookPurchase中的BookInfo數據表中,完成數據導入工作,具體實現的關鍵程序如下:

①讀取上傳到服務器里的Excel文件,首先定義連接到Excel中的連接字段:

②然后打開連接字段,將數據填充到 OleDb-DataAdapter的基本類中,然后再轉到ADO.NET基本類DataSet中:

③將DataSet中數據導入SQL Server數據庫中,首先打開數據庫連接

然后,統計數據行數,用來控制插入最后一條數據:

定義插入數據庫SQL語句:

將DataSet中數據逐一插入數據庫中:

3.2 圖書采購組模塊的設計

圖書采購組模塊是圖書訂購工作的關鍵環節,在整個采購工作中起到“把關”作用,讀者推薦的圖書需訂購的復本量、對推薦圖書進行查重后剔除館藏已收藏圖書工作是圖書采購組的主要工作,下面以“薦購信息處理”子模塊為例進行界面設計和代碼分析,工作界面如圖2所示。

圖2 薦購圖書信息處理界面截圖

圖書采購組工作人員只需在需要訂購的圖書的“報訂數”字段中填入訂購的復本量,點擊“報訂本頁所要求數量的圖書”按鈕,即完成報訂工作,系統會自動生成訂單供圖書供應商下載并配書。設計該模塊代碼中,最難的地方是要在界面中顯示出館藏數量和已訂數量這兩個字段,涉及多個數據庫間的連接,數據庫中的薦購信息表要與館藏信息表以及訂購信息表三個表進行連接,才能達到目的,該連接的字符串為:

3.3 圖書驗收組模塊的設計

圖書驗收處理是整個圖書采購工作的重要環節,網上推薦圖書,方便且高效,但非實物圖書薦購,待訂購圖書到館后,還需要經過圖書驗收組驗收處理,剔除裝幀不符合館藏要求、供應商配送錯誤等不合要求的圖書,保證好圖書品質,保障經費發揮最大效用。圖書驗收組收到到館圖書后,登陸系統,通過電子掃描槍輸入圖書ISBN號,可以快速檢索該種圖書的訂購信息,并初始化好驗收的復本數量進行驗收工作。若驗收的圖書為已訂購圖書,且符合館藏要求,則可對此類圖書驗收進館,若不符合館藏要求,則可退回書商,若驗收的圖書為未訂購的圖書,可能是圖書供應商誤配書,但該類圖書若適合館藏,驗收人員仍然可以對其驗收進館收藏,若不適合館藏,也一樣可以退回書商,只是需要補充完整書名、價格、訂購價、圖書供應商等信息就可以存入相關數據庫中,完成該種圖書的驗收。該模塊的關鍵代碼如下:

①掃描將驗收的圖書的ISBN后,將查詢此圖書是否為訂購圖書,并查詢此圖書進館及退書情況,然后綁定在Gridview控件中顯示:

②若圖書為已訂購圖書,并且裝幀等情況都合適館藏,點擊界面中的驗收進館按鈕,將把GridView中選中的數據插入到進館信息數據表中:

4 結語

筆者提出了用微軟最新.NET技術設計與實現網上圖書薦購系統,并重點論述了系統幾個關鍵功能的實現方法。系統的開發充分考慮到圖書查重及驗收功能,有效地解決了圖書館傳統采訪模式所存在的不足。各模塊子功能全面,支持多個圖書供應商同時提供服務,圖書供應商可以直接從下載訂書數據模塊中下載屬于自己的訂單,圖書采購組人員也可以在自己所屬模塊中的訂書信息管理子模塊中下載訂購信息,圖書驗收組可以對進書數據、退書數據以及未到圖書數據進行分類管理。它與傳統采訪工作中的經驗相結合,相互支持、相互補充,對提高圖書館的文獻收藏質量將會有很大的幫助。

[1]李豫誠.高校圖書館薦購功能研究[D].碩士論文.重慶:西南大學,2010.

[2]曹玉平.網上薦購圖書的探討[J].圖書館學刊,2006(2):57-58.

[3]Gao Fengrong.Research on Individual Information Recommendation System in Digital Library.Information Studies:Theory & Application.2003(4):359-362.

[4]F.M.E.Uzoka,O.A.Ijatuyi.Decision Support System for Library Acquisitions:A Framework.The Electronic Library,2005(4):453-462.

[5]牛振恒.圖書館采購系統設計及主要功能需求分析[J].圖書情報工作,2006(3):81-83.

[6]劉曉雁.高校圖書館圖書薦購系統調查分析[J].現代情報,2008(4):162-163.

猜你喜歡
數據庫圖書館信息
圖書館
小太陽畫報(2018年1期)2018-05-14 17:19:25
訂閱信息
中華手工(2017年2期)2017-06-06 23:00:31
數據庫
財經(2017年2期)2017-03-10 14:35:35
飛躍圖書館
數據庫
財經(2016年15期)2016-06-03 07:38:02
數據庫
財經(2016年3期)2016-03-07 07:44:46
數據庫
財經(2016年6期)2016-02-24 07:41:51
圖書館里的是是非非
展會信息
中外會展(2014年4期)2014-11-27 07:46:46
去圖書館
主站蜘蛛池模板: 草逼视频国产| 成人久久18免费网站| 尤物在线观看乱码| 国产高清在线精品一区二区三区| aaa国产一级毛片| 五月婷婷中文字幕| 午夜精品福利影院| 97精品国产高清久久久久蜜芽| 亚洲中文字幕久久精品无码一区| 久久综合九色综合97网| 免费国产不卡午夜福在线观看| 美女内射视频WWW网站午夜| 永久免费AⅤ无码网站在线观看| 亚洲成人高清无码| 久久精品中文字幕免费| 国产美女精品在线| 欧美成人免费一区在线播放| 一区二区在线视频免费观看| 四虎精品黑人视频| 亚洲熟女偷拍| 国产精品一区二区久久精品无码| 国内精品视频在线| 国产精品蜜芽在线观看| 久久91精品牛牛| 亚洲国产成熟视频在线多多 | 日韩第九页| 欧美人与动牲交a欧美精品| 婷婷色婷婷| 欧美日韩综合网| 伊人激情久久综合中文字幕| 国产一区成人| 51国产偷自视频区视频手机观看| 嫩草在线视频| 成人精品视频一区二区在线| 亚洲精品天堂在线观看| 亚洲第一精品福利| 香蕉精品在线| 亚洲国产欧美国产综合久久| 丁香六月综合网| 国产精品第5页| 伊在人亚洲香蕉精品播放| 中文字幕亚洲精品2页| 亚洲午夜国产片在线观看| 国产精品偷伦视频免费观看国产| 日韩无码真实干出血视频| 国产乱人视频免费观看| 久久国产拍爱| 日韩欧美中文字幕在线韩免费| 女人一级毛片| 又黄又湿又爽的视频| 无码福利日韩神码福利片| 久久久精品国产亚洲AV日韩| 成人字幕网视频在线观看| 亚洲综合一区国产精品| 狠狠躁天天躁夜夜躁婷婷| 1024国产在线| 免费看黄片一区二区三区| 91亚洲影院| 亚洲AⅤ无码国产精品| 国产三区二区| 91尤物国产尤物福利在线| 丁香六月综合网| 欧美日韩一区二区三区四区在线观看| 婷婷综合在线观看丁香| 一区二区三区国产| 亚洲天堂视频网站| 国产精品永久不卡免费视频| 男人天堂亚洲天堂| 国产网站黄| 国产永久在线视频| 色偷偷一区二区三区| 久久久久久久久18禁秘| 91福利在线看| 国产精品太粉嫩高中在线观看| 国产一区二区网站| 天天综合色网| 亚洲欧美激情小说另类| 第一页亚洲| 无码高潮喷水在线观看| 国产精品黑色丝袜的老师| 欧美日韩另类国产| 国产主播喷水|